A member asked:

I have been taking toprol (metoprolol) for over two weeks for high bp &tachycardia. i seem to be gaining weight & am very tired. is this normal?

3 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Tired? yes.: Toprol's main side effect is fatigue but people usually get used it over several weeks. If you're exercising less and sitting around, possibly eating more, you'll gain weight but i wouldn't blame the toprol (metoprolol) for that. If the side effects are unacceptable, it helps to halve the dose for 2 weeks, and then build up a full dose.

Yes.: Felling tired and weight gain are side effects of beta blockers. If does not get better, check with your md and ask them to switch to different med.
